#da1679 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#da1679 is composed of 85.5% red, 8.6%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.9% magenta, 44.5%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 329.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 47.1%. #da1679 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2cf2 with #b50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#da1679

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040002 is the darkest color, while #fef1f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#da1679

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7278 is the less saturated color, while #ec0479 is the most saturated one.
